Output 891a6b413e3c70a53cf3353cd1b3289807b7fea376b5a6f782ba249fbe02ae8c:1

value
642793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c85353cd35a93789763ecc97ed0f3f75ffb0cab9 OP_EQUAL
address
3KxEtbVuSTua4JKZvSQ38PyLpKUdDYR6R8
transaction
891a6b413e3c70a53cf3353cd1b3289807b7fea376b5a6f782ba249fbe02ae8c
spent
true